We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ent ac09db4 commit d28cf36Copy full SHA for d28cf36
intelmq/bots/outputs/templated_smtp/output.py
@@ -94,6 +94,7 @@
94
import ssl
95
from typing import List, Optional
96
from email.message import EmailMessage
97
+from email import policy
98
try:
99
from jinja2 import Template
100
except:
@@ -190,7 +191,7 @@ def process(self):
190
191
if self.smtp_authentication:
192
smtp.login(user=self.username, password=self.password)
193
- msg = EmailMessage()
194
+ msg = EmailMessage(policy=policy.SMTPUTF8)
195
msg['Subject'] = self.templates["subject"].render(event=event)
196
msg['From'] = self.templates["from"].render(event=event)
197
msg['To'] = self.templates["to"].render(event=event)
0 commit comments